The much cooler predecessor to the loonie, this silver dollar was struck from 1935 to 1968. It depicts King George V on the front with a canoe containing a voyageur and Indigenous man on the back. The canoe also contains two bundles of furs - on one, the initials H.B. for Hudson’s Bay Company. It was to live on as a new gold-coloured coin however the dies depicting the design were “lost in transit”. To prevent the risk of counterfeiting, an alternate design featuring a loon was used.
